Julia Maksimowicz: Therapiez: Piezoelectric Wearable Wound-Healing Research
Therapiez: Piezoelectric Wearable Wound-Healing Research.
Julia Maksimowicz developed Therapiez, a piezoelectric system incorporated into a wearable medical device for accelerated wound-healing therapy. Piezoelectric materials generate an electrical response under mechanical stress, creating opportunities for wearables that interact with healing tissue.

Official project title: Therapiez: A Piezoelectric System in a Wearable Medical Device for Accelerated Wound Healing Therapy (Biomedical Engineering).
IP note
No public IP record; any filing made around the May 2025 fair would not yet be published under the 18-month rule — register check due from late 2026.
Recognition
Regeneron ISEF 2025 — Third Award ($1,200).
